Travel from the United Kingdom will continue to be Orlando's darling when it comes to airline seating capacity, but the same can't be said for Brazil ' normally the No. 1 overseas market for the region.
Trends show airlines bringing more Brits to Central Florida next year, despite all the kerfuffle regarding the Brexit vote and the impact that can have on the British economy. The U.K. traditionally has been Orlando's No. 2 overseas market, but it looks like it will take over the top spot this...
